February is Black History Month. This year, the Government of Canada’s theme, “Black Excellence: A Heritage to Celebrate; A Future to Build,” honours Black peoples’ past, present and future accomplishments.

On Feb. 20, the Black Legacy Committee (BLC) at UHN hosted its third event of The Colour of Proper Care speaker series, which created a space to reflect on multidimensional ancestral legacies.

In 2024, the 10th year of the International Decade for People of African Descent is being marked. It invites reflection on the global African Diaspora and its remarkable impact on Canadian and world history. The African Diaspora is the voluntary and involuntary movement of Africans and their descendants to various parts of the world during the modern and pre-modern periods.

It is essential to appreciate and acknowledge the historic and ongoing contributions of Black people in Canada as foundational to our health care system and society.
